Quantities are limited\, so pre-order today! \n************************************************************************************ \nAn orphan races to uncover a killer—who may have come from the sea—when she and her beloved orcas fall under suspicion in this historical gothic mystery from the New York Times bestselling author of The Downstairs Girl\, Stacey Lee. \n1918. Orcas Island\, Washington. \nLucy Nowhere has spent her eighteen years working on the vast estate of the eccentric shipbuilder who took her in after she washed ashore in a green canoe as a baby. But she has long wished for a life off the island\, and in a matter of days\, she is set to leave for college—and\, for the first time\, choose her own future. \nThen she finds her employer’s severed head on the beach. Rumors swirl that a mischievous spirit and its minions\, the sea wolves\, have struck again. Lucy doesn’t believe in myths. She knows that a human—a human murderer—killed him. And when she is unexpectedly named heiress to the estate\, she understands the next target is her. \nHer closest friend\, the estate’s vigilant young guard\, begs her to escape while she can. But Lucy knows the only way she can discover who she is\, and free the island of its curse\, is to find the real killer—before she becomes the next victim.
